5 // A send algorithm which adds pacing on top of an another send algorithm. | 5 // A send algorithm which adds pacing on top of an another send algorithm. |
6 // It uses the underlying sender's bandwidth estimate to determine the | 6 // It uses the underlying sender's bandwidth estimate to determine the |
7 // pacing rate to be used. It also takes into consideration the expected | 7 // pacing rate to be used. It also takes into consideration the expected |
8 // resolution of the underlying alarm mechanism to ensure that alarms are | 8 // resolution of the underlying alarm mechanism to ensure that alarms are |
9 // not set too aggressively, and to smooth out variations. | 9 // not set too aggressively, and to smooth out variations. |
